I think the background image should say
Code:
return 0;
instead of
Code:
return 1;
as it's standard for 0 to mean exit with success and 1 to mean an error (well, any non-zero value is an error, but the program can use them to mean different errors).
EDIT: Shouldn't the C++ hello world program have a ; after using namespace std ?
